
Fintech startup Six Clovers launched the Versal Network on the Sui blockchain. The network is designed to facilitate faster, more cost-effective and secure cross-border payments. The Block.
The company was founded in 2021 by people from PayPal. It has attracted venture capital investments from Borderless Capital, BCW Group and Grupo Supervielle.
According to the statement, Six Clovers API allows enterprises to integrate the Versal Network into their technology stacks to enable real-time stablecoin and CBDC transactions.
The project aims to bridge the gap between established Web 2.0 and Web3 commerce by “abstracting the blockchain and making the infrastructure invisible to customers,” said Jim Nguyen, co-founder and CEO of Six Clovers.
Versal Network is considered as an alternative to SWIFT payment channels based on more modern technologies. The network operates around the clock, eliminating intermediaries, speeding up settlements, maintaining regulatory compliance and transaction confidentiality.
The first-level blockchain Sui Network was developed by Mysten Labs, a startup founded by ex-engineers of the Meta cryptocurrency project. The launch of the main network took place on May 3. The testnet has been operating since November 2022.
“Sui offers infinite scalability that is ideal for the next generation Web3 payment network. The toolkit created by Six Clovers allows any enterprise to seamlessly integrate blockchain-based payments into their enterprise applications,” said Greg Siorunis, managing director of the Sui Foundation.
Recall that in May, the Mysten Labs team announced a collaboration with many development companies to launch Web3 games on the blockchain. In June, the project became a partner of the Red Bull Formula 1 team with an eye on gaming initiatives.
